Description

We're seeking an experienced Process Engineer with a strong background in industrial automation, robotics, and manufacturing process optimization to support automation initiatives across multiple manufacturing sites.
 
Location: Fort Mill, SC (Onsite)
Duration: 7-Month Contract
Pay Rate: $52.88/hr.
 
Key Responsibilities:
  • Lead automation and controls projects from concept through implementation.
  • Design, integrate, and optimize PLC, SCADA, robotics, and industrial control systems.
  • Drive process improvements focused on safety, quality, productivity, and automation.
  • Partner with operations, engineering, IT, and quality teams to implement manufacturing solutions.
  • Support capital projects, equipment commissioning, and continuous improvement initiatives.
 
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Automation,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 3+ years of experience in manufacturing, industrial automation, or process engineering.
  • Hands-on experience with PLC programming, SCADA systems, industrial networking, and robotics.
  • Experience with Rockwell, Siemens, Python scripting, Lean Manufacturing, TPM, and process optimization.
  • Six Sigma Green Belt and project leadership experience are a plus.
